Love to Hate You Kindle Edition
She needs arm candy, he needs her insurance, but first, they need to drive across the country without killing each other.
Eli
Since the first day of kindergarten, I have hated Alexandra Hartford.
And twenty-something years later that hasn’t changed.
But she has.
She’s still a tomboy with a chip on her shoulder, but now she’s a hot tomboy with a chip on her tattooed shoulder who can fight like a badass.
I’d still rather have a bath with fire ants than spend ten days in a car with her, but she has something I need.
Once the deal is done, we can go our separate ways.
That is … if I want to.
Alex
Eli Evans is my nemesis.
He blames me for his sister’s death, our parents’ divorces, and probably global warming, too.
Why on Earth would I help him?
Because he’s as easy on the eyes as he is the bane of my existence and I need a hot date to a wedding in San Diego.
Can we drive across the country without me leaving him at a truck stop somewhere? I doubt it.
But, I’m willing to try.
Ten days in a car, a wedding, and a marriage of convenience, then I’m done with him forever.
Right?

- Reviewed in the United States on March 9, 2022Love to Hate You has given me a large dose of one of my favorite tropes! Enemies to lovers is always a favorite of mine and Alex & Eli have certainly ticked off all of those boxes.
Alexandra Hartford and Eli Evans have danced around one another since grade school. She was his twin sisters' best friend and confidant, so when Eden Evans died, he placed some of the blame on Alex.
Eli has been her childhood nemesis for years. The enemy always there whether it was on the playground, the halls of high school or now years later in her own hometown. When Eli presents with himself as a new man that has had a change of heart Alex is more than suspicious.
Eli Evans is a traveling man that has found himself rooted in Maine due to a heath condition and a doctor that resides there. Now all he needs is the best insurance money could buy or a miracle to help him get the procedure he needs to save his eyesight. He is more than surprised when he finds his old sparring frenemy living in the same town. He soon realizes that she is not the Alex he remembers and the more time he spends in her presence the more he wants to know.
Alex has just come off a break-up, is in need of a fake plus one and has just run into Eli. He has a proposition for her, and she may need to bite the bullet and take it. It will truly benefit both of them in the long run but at what cost?
A friendly wager, a little bit of boxing and the deal is done but we soon see that they may have just scratched the surface of the new people they have become.
This was an emotional journey that will take Eli and Alex on a road trip of self-discover, honesty, so many feelings, angst and a whole lot of undeclared love!

- Reviewed in the United States on March 14, 2022Love to Hate You is an enemies to lovers romance and holy cow are these two enemies when this story begins. Eli and Alex have known each other--a term I use loosely--since they were in kindergarten. She was best friends with his twin sister and he was her bully, her tormetor.
They were hardcore enemies who found themselves living in the same small Maine town years after their lives were blown apart by tragedy and circumstances.
The story itself is mostly entertaining.
Mostly.
My major problem is that I just could not warm up to Eli. I understand where his misdirected anger came from, but those first few chapters just soured me on him and I never recovered from what he said about Alex. I just couldn't. Not sorry.
But they make a deal which I won't spoil for you except to say it's a fake relationship/marriage of convenience which mostly takes place on a road trip. I appreciated the growth shown by both throughout the trip and the heat between them was HOLY SMOKES OFF THE CHARTS!! Together, they burn up the sheets and my kindle.
The story itself was good even if I didn't like Eli all the way to the very end. I loved Alex though. She was scarred and tough and brilliant and managed to find ways to navigate her pain that were healthy and positive. She is exactly the kind of heroine you can and want to root for, and I did. She wanted Eli and I wanted her to get what she wanted, it's as simple as that.
Good read, meh hero and awesome heroine.
